Product reviews:
Tamiya | CC-01 Landrover Defender 90 rc land rover defender 90
rc land rover defender 90
Tim
2025-06-10 iphone 6s Plus
scale rc Land Rover defender 90 feat rc land rover defender 90
rc land rover defender 90
Julian
2025-06-17 iphone 11
Tamiya Land Rover Defender 90 - RC Car rc land rover defender 90
rc land rover defender 90